Depending on where you live, there will be issues with any cell-phone service especially if you live near the ocean or work in a large building.
In my case, the dropped call areas are very predictable and were an issue with both Verizon and Nextel, so I don't blame AT&T.
With that being said, the Iphone is a game-changer for sure. Traffic maps, email, texting, and the free applications are all very useful and work pretty fast. If you do switch service I would recomend that you input your contacts into your Mac from your Nokia and sync them when you do your Iphone syncing.
